Thenorthend ref 05.32 post I am not sure where you get that IslandMagee is dead in the water. The Marine License was granted on October 13. There were a number of conditions some of which need to be complied with before any of the work covered by the marine license can start. To comply with all those conditions will take until Q2 2022. It will take 36 months to build the first stage of IslandMagee. Can you point to any factual basis for saying that IslandMagee is dead in the water. I would observe that depending on how it is calculated the period within which to bring a judicial review has either only just expired or will not expire until 8 February. Whether the issuing of a judicial review would prevent the construction starting is dependent on a matter that I am not going to go into on this board.
